CONCORD, N.C. — Mrs. Margaret Cochran Furr, 88, of 4291 Roberta Road, Concord, died March 30, 1998, at her home. Funeral services will be conducted 2 p.m. Thursday at Roberta Baptist Church with Rev. Steve Pennington officiating. Burial will follow in the Roberta Methodist Church Cemetery. The family will receive friends Wednesday from 7-9 p.m. at the Wilkinson Funeral Home and will be at the home the remainder of the time. Mrs. Furr was retired from Cannon Mills and was a member of Roberta Baptist Church. She was born in Cabarrus County on July 1, 1909 to the late Robert C. and Annie Dulin Cochran. She was preceded in death by her husband, Glenn E. Furr who died December 12, 1973. She is survived by two daughters, Mrs. Geneva F. Lefler of Concord and Mrs. Betty F. Lefler of Hamptonville, N.C.; one son, Mr. Gene Furr of Concord; two sisters, Mrs. Elizabeth Hooks of Concord and Mrs. Edith Griggs of Charlotte; one brother, Mr. Budge Cochran of Concord; five grandchildren; four great-granchildren.
